Havok explosions are never going to go away. They're an integral part of the physics engine the game uses, and we'd have to get into the .exe file to alter it, which nobody has managed so far.

I also always wonder how people get these high quality skins in RA2. For me, everything always turns out in the typical bad RA2 quality.
You want to resize the .bmp file to either 512x512, or 1024x1024. Anything higher is a waste, in my view. Bear in mind that you won't be able to modify it in-game if you up the resolution, though.
